Montesquieu in his Spirit of Laws , demanded that the judiciary was entrusted to courts not permanent, formed by non-professionals drawn from the people. These popular temporary judges, as the French philosopher, should be only "the mouth of the law", thus creating a power invisible and null ". We must avoid it, Montesquieu thought that the court is also the legislature. Because in this case, the power over life and the freedom of citizens would be arbitrary.


The concerns of the great French are still to be shared , although the complexity of contemporary art requires the necessary space to professionalism.
According to the 'Article 101 of the Italian Constitution:

"Justice is administered in the name of the people.
Judges are subject only to the law."


In liberal terms we could say that justice must be administered in the name citizens to meet their need for protection. Nothing more and nothing less.
